Design from a poet, a philosopher – a design author. Objects designed out of passion and curiosity for life, creation and the unknowable. Objects of passion: full of vitality, play and humour. Design that makes you wonder and reflect, love or hate. Design that tells its – minuscule – narratives. The Carlo collection is a revitalisation of some of the master’s greatest designs, including the Miró chair, the Ran bookcase, and the Signorina Chan, Alien and Cotton Club chairs.

Ran Library is inspired and influenced by Japanese and Chinese temple gates in both structure and aesthetic appearance. Ran Library is a self-supporting bookcase that leans up against the wall – as proud and strong as a samurai warrior. It is named after the iconic film directed by Japanese filmmaker Akira Kurosawa.
Dimensions:
W 1120 x D 457 x H 2040 mm
Materials:
Structure in black painted steel
Shelfs available in wood veneer or glossy lacquer finish
